Watermelon Cucumber Salad

  • 2 cups watermelon cubes
  • 1 cup cucumber cubes
  • 2 tablespoons mint leaves, chopped
  • juice and rind of a small lime
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il

The amount listed above are approximate.  I cubed half of a small watermelon, and half of an English cucumber, threw in the chopped mint, grated the lime rind over it, squeezed the lime juice over it and sprinkled the olive oil over it and then tossed it about with a couple of spoons. It was very light and refreshing. I will definitely make it again, perhaps adding half a cup of quinoa and a quarter cup of crumbled feta cheese. I think they would complement it nicely. Makes 3 one cup servings at one WW point each, or, if you left out the oil (wouldn’t hurt), it would be zero points.
